Mike Edmunds 978996d7b8 Test without optional packages
Tox:
* Add Tox factor for extras (all, none, individual ESP).
  For now, only break out ESPs that have specific extra
  dependencies (amazon_ses, sparkpost).
* Install most package dependencies (including extras)
  through the package itself.
* Use new runtests.py environment vars to limit test tags
  when Tox isn't installing all extras.

Travis:
* Rework matrix to request specific TOXENVs directly;
  drop tox-travis.

Test runner (runtests.py):
* Centralize RUN_LIVE_TESTS logic in runtests.py
* Add ANYMAIL_ONLY_TEST and ANYMAIL_SKIP_TESTS env vars
  (comma-separated lists of tags)

Test implementations:
* Tag all ESP-specific tests with ESP
* Tag live tests with "live"
* Don't import ESP-specific packages at test module level. 
  (Test discovery imports test modules before tag-based filtering.)

Closes #104

@tag('amazon_ses')
class AmazonSESInboundTests(WebhookTestCase, AmazonSESWebhookTestsMixin):
def setUp(self):
super(AmazonSESInboundTests, self).setUp()
# Mock boto3.session.Session().client('s3').download_fileobj
# (We could also use botocore.stub.Stubber, but mock works well with our test structure)
self.patch_boto3_session = patch('anymail.webhooks.amazon_ses.boto3.session.Session', autospec=True)
self.mock_session = self.patch_boto3_session.start() # boto3.session.Session
self.addCleanup(self.patch_boto3_session.stop)
def mock_download_fileobj(bucket, key, fileobj):
fileobj.write(self.mock_s3_downloadables[bucket][key])
self.mock_s3_downloadables = {} # bucket: key: bytes
self.mock_client = self.mock_session.return_value.client # boto3.session.Session().client
self.mock_s3 = self.mock_client.return_value # boto3.session.Session().client('s3', ...)
self.mock_s3.download_fileobj.side_effect = mock_download_fileobj

def test_inbound_s3_failure_message(self):
"""Issue a helpful error when S3 download fails"""
# Boto's error: "An error occurred (403) when calling the HeadObject operation: Forbidden")
from botocore.exceptions import ClientError
self.mock_s3.download_fileobj.side_effect = ClientError(
{'Error': {'Code': 403, 'Message': 'Forbidden'}}, operation_name='HeadObject')
raw_ses_event = {
"notificationType": "Received",
"receipt": {
"action": {"type": "S3", "bucketName": "YourBucket", "objectKey": "inbound/the_object_key"}
},
}
raw_sns_message = {
"Type": "Notification",
"MessageId": "8f6dee70-c885-558a-be7d-bd48bbf5335e",
"TopicArn": "arn:aws:sns:us-east-1:111111111111:SES_Inbound",
"Message": json.dumps(raw_ses_event),
}
with self.assertRaisesMessage(
AnymailAPIError,
"Anymail AmazonSESInboundWebhookView couldn't download S3 object 'YourBucket:inbound/the_object_key'"
) as cm:
self.post_from_sns('/anymail/amazon_ses/inbound/', raw_sns_message)
self.assertIsInstance(cm.exception, ClientError) # both Boto and Anymail exception class
self.assertIn("ClientError: An error occurred (403) when calling the HeadObject operation: Forbidden",
str(cm.exception)) # original Boto message included
def test_incorrect_tracking_event(self):
"""The inbound webhook should warn if it receives tracking events"""
raw_sns_message = {
"Type": "Notification",
"MessageId": "8f6dee70-c885-558a-be7d-bd48bbf5335e",
"TopicArn": "arn:...:111111111111:SES_Tracking",
"Message": '{"notificationType": "Delivery"}',
}
with self.assertRaisesMessage(
AnymailConfigurationError,
"You seem to have set an Amazon SES *sending* event or notification to publish to an SNS Topic "
"that posts to Anymail's *inbound* webhook URL. (SNS TopicArn arn:...:111111111111:SES_Tracking)"
):
self.post_from_sns('/anymail/amazon_ses/inbound/', raw_sns_message)
